Way too fat

A third of all women in Barbados are obese and three-fifths are overweight, while one man in ten is obese and one-third are overweight.
These are some statistics Professor Trevor Hassell revealed to the SATURDAY SUN yesterday when he addressed the issue of chronic non-communicable diseases (NCDs) on his return from the United Nations High Level Meeting on the topic.
Hassell said 54 000 Barbadians suffered from hypertension or high blood pressure – that is, one-fifth of the population.
“For goodness sake, we are a population of 280 000, and 54 000 of them have got high blood pressure. By the time you get to 65 years and over, two-thirds, meaning two out of every three persons, will have high blood pressure,” he said. (TM)
